Sports aplenty this weekend


Staff reports

Men's basketball opens its home schedule with a non-conference game against Charlotte (1-1) Saturday at The Pyramid. Game time is 1:05 p.m.
 
The 49ers went 2-1 at the America's Youth Classic last weekend. Senior Rudy Williams averaged 16.0 points and 5.3 rebounds during the three games and was named to the all-tournament team.
 
Guard Jobey Thomas leads Charlotte in scoring at 15.5 points per game and Demon Brown averages 13.5 ppg.
 
Women's basketball travels to Fairbanks, Ala. to take part in the Mt. McKinley North Star Invitational Friday and Saturday. The Beach opens with Western Illinois on Friday at 7 p.m. and will play either Eastern Illinois or Alaska-Fairbanks Saturday.
 
Newcomer Jinga Gosschalk led the Beach (0-1) with 20 points during its season-opening loss to Syracuse.
 
Men's water polo plays in the Mountain Pacific Sports Federation Championships Friday through Sunday in Berkeley.
 
LBSU (12-6) opens against Pepperdine in the first round on Friday at 11:00 am.
 
Chris Segesman leads the 49ers in scoring with 36 goals, including 28 in his last 10 games, and has 164 career goals.
 
The top-ranked women's volleyball team hosts the Thanksgiving Classic Friday and Saturday at The Pyramid. The Beach plays Weber State Friday at 2:00 p.m. and Pittsburgh Friday at 7:30 p.m. The 49ers close the tournament against Brigham Young Saturday at 7:30 p.m.
